Background: This retrospective review aimed to assess if open payments made by industry arthroplasty companies to physicians and hospital systems were significantly affected by implant type and geographic variation. Methods: Data was obtained from the Centers for Medicare and Medicaid Services (CMS) publicly available open payment datasets (2016-2019). Geographic locations were identified using regions as defined by the US Census Bureau. A linear regression was calculated to predict the open payment made based on the created variable region, the most used implant type (reverse vs anatomic, n > 30 to be included), and their hypothesized interaction. Results: A significant regression equation was found for the hypothesized interaction between implant and region, F(13,11 186) = 3.446, P < .0001, with an R2 of 0.005. Within the regression, the implant type alone was not significantly related to the open payment (P = .070) but only became significant when paired with the region in the South (US$5807; P < .0001) and West (US$5638; P = .0012) compared to the Northeast. Discussion: Our multivariate linear regression model revealed that reverse total shoulder implants were associated with higher open payments, but only within the South and West regions. This indicates that the contributions made by industry arthroplasty companies are a function of both implant and region.

Background: The purpose of this study is to evaluate the impact of the COVID-19 pandemic on shoulder procedure volumes reported to the Accreditation Council for Graduate Medical Education by orthopedic surgery residents. Methods: We performed a retrospective review of Accreditation Council for Graduate Medical Education case logs reporting data from graduating orthopedic surgery residents during the academic years of 2006-2022. Data were queried for all patients for the following shoulder Current Procedural Terminology codes: incision, excision, intro or removal, repair/revision/reconstruction, fracture and/or dislocation, manipulation, arthroscopy, trauma, and total procedures performed. Individual t-tests were used to compare case log trends of graduating academic years before (classes of 2018 and 2019) and during (classes of 2020, 2021, and 2022) the COVID-19 pandemic. Statistical significance was established to be P <.05 for total procedure types, but at P <.005 during category comparisons to protect against alpha errors. Results: Reported mean total shoulder procedures per resident steadily increased each year from 2017 to 2022, but the only significant increase was seen when comparing the graduating classes of 2020 to 2021 (157.9 vs. 165.7, P =.02). Stratification of these procedures by subgroup revealed a significant increase in manipulation procedures from 2021 to 2022 (7.3 vs. 8.8, P =.001). Discussion/Conclusion: COVID-19 did not have a negative impact on logged shoulder procedure volume. Orthopedic surgery residents graduating during the COVID-19 pandemic reported more shoulder procedures than those graduating prepandemic. However, shoulder procedure log trends should be longitudinally investigated, as preceding years of procedural opportunities may underestimate the pandemic's impact.

OBJECTIVE: It is unclear what the optimal upper extremity hemodialysis access is for patients without a suitable cephalic vein for arteriovenous fistulas (AVFs). The objective of this systematic review and meta-analysis was to compare the outcomes for upper extremity transposed brachiobasilic AVFs (BBAVFs) and prosthetic arteriovenous grafts (AVGs). METHODS: A systematic review was performed to identify all English publications and abstracts comparing the patency outcomes of upper extremity BBAVFs and AVGs (January 1st, 1994 to April 1st, 2020). The outcomes assessed were 1-year and 2-year primary and secondary patency rates. Pooled odds ratios (OR) were calculated using the random-effects model, and I2 statistic was used to assess between-study variability. RESULTS: Twenty-three studies examining 2799 patients were identified and included in the study. The 1-year primary patency rates (OR = 1.68, 95% CI 1.24-2.28, p = 0.001, I2 = 69.40%) and 2-year primary patency rates (OR = 2.33, 95% CI 1.59-3.43, p < 0.001, I2 = 68.26%) were significantly better for BBAVFs than AVGs. Compared to AVGs, the 1-year secondary patency rates (OR = 1.45, 95% CI 1.05-1.98, p = 0.022, I2 = 56.64%) and 2-year secondary patency rates (OR = 1.93, 95% CI 1.39-2.68, p < 0.001, I2 = 57.61%) were also significantly higher for BBAVFs. CONCLUSION: The outcomes for upper extremity BBAVFs appear to be consistently superior to prosthetic hemodialysis access. This analysis supports the preferential placement of BBAVFs over AVGs in patients with a suitable upper extremity basilic vein.
